Sign Ups
- Added a new query option to the real-time sign up kiosk url of &all=true which will return every topic even if engage is turned off on it. The purpose of this query is for those cities who want to use digital signup but prefer staff to fill it all out instead of citizens. This way it will give them total control in real time
Engage
- Agenda Items are now delivered with the same design as the pdf generated reports (this includes for minutes and searching results)
- The custom minutes header is now also what is used when delivering the digital minutes to the public through the engage portal in addition to the pdf versions (for older minutes prior to this capability it will auto-inject some basic information about that meeting)
- Added new "Live Player" that will work with CableCast livestream iframe. The meetings page will auto update for any meeting that is currently active (not in test mode) with its own live player url as long as you have the cablecast info in the integrations section of settings.
- Updated the player page to utilize the same updated design for showing agenda topic information underneath the video
Live
- We've updated the slide outs and information in the middle of the screens to show staff reports with the same style that is done in pdfs just like we updated on the engage site
- For boards where the mayor only votes in the case of a tie-breaker we have updated the manager's screen during a live meeting so they can submit a no-vote. Previously that button was only the mayor's screen.
